Deity for Performance Artist (build advice also welcome)


Advice


Working on a chakram or boomerang specialist for an upcoming campaign and I'm trying to flesh out character backstory. I'm going to be using Startoss Style, Ricochet Toss, and as many Advanced Weapon Training options as possible. Leaning heavily on the Weapon Master archetype, although with GM permission I may go Eldritch Guardian with a monkey (or suitable Improved Familiar later on), although that limits me to boomerang, since I need to pick some manner of Exotic Weapon (EG-based familiar gets to share proficiency only when it's via combat feat).

They're a wanderer specializing in a single thrown weapon, history of using games of skill (ring toss, darts, billiards if there's a setting equivalent, etc). Trying to figure out the best deity for them.

I'm looking over areas of concern, and trying to determine what manual marksmanship and trick shots falls closest to. Not concerned about the 'prominence' of the deity, since I can't imagine myself pursuing Deific Obedience or any of the associated prestige classes.
Shelyn - art
Kurgess - competition, sport
Bharnarol - creativity, persistence
Svarozic - ingenuity, refinement

Any feedback on a deity selection, or general build advice, is welcome. Thank you. (:


I'd go with Kurgess since he represents competitions typically relying on skill.

consider the trait strong arm, supple wrist since it increases your range for thrown weapons when you move more than 10 ft, but its only good once per round.

I wouldnt go with Eldritch guardian, because to make a familiar effective in combat requires a lot of feats, and you won't quite be able to break even with using thrown weapon feats.

I'm not sure, but that shouldn't matter for you; startoss style only works if you are wielding only one weapon. It's basically intended to make up for getting fewer number of attacks as compared to a TWF thrower.


chakram can be used in melee but its considered a one-handed weapon, and doesn't contain a line saying weapon finesse can be used with it even though its only 1 lb, so your gm might say its fine for weapon finesse.

dont know about boomerang.
